RoyalSlider插件:打造动态视频画廊的前端解决方案
版权申诉
168 浏览量
更新于2024-11-29
收藏 359KB ZIP 举报
资源摘要信息:"视频画廊RoyalSlider插件"
1. 插件概述
RoyalSlider是一款基于jQuery的HTML5图像画廊和内容滑动器插件,它允许开发者在网页中创建响应式、触摸滑动的画廊,同时也支持视频、幻灯片等多种内容类型。该插件广泛应用于网页设计和开发中,用来增强用户界面的交互性和视觉效果。
2. 技术栈与兼容性
RoyalSlider插件是建立在jQuery框架之上的,这要求开发者在使用前需要在项目中引入jQuery库。此外,它也使用了HTML5和CSS3技术,确保了丰富的样式和布局的灵活性。插件还支持纯CSS模式,以避免JavaScript的依赖,从而提高了兼容性。
3. 功能特性
- 触摸滑动和缩放支持:用户可以通过触摸设备进行滑动操作,同时支持多点触控缩放图片。
- 视频集成:能够将视频内容嵌入画廊中,与图片内容无缝切换。
- 多种布局模式:支持水平、垂直和网格布局,以适应不同场景下的设计需求。
- 动画和过渡效果:提供多种内置的过渡动画效果,包括淡入淡出、滑动等。
- 自定义皮肤:可以通过CSS来定制画廊的外观,以符合网站的整体风格。
- 全屏模式:用户可以点击按钮将画廊放大至全屏,提升观看体验。
4. 应用场景
- 网站画廊展示:企业或个人网站可以使用RoyalSlider来展示产品、作品集或服务。
- 电子商务:电商平台可以利用该插件作为商品展示的画廊,提高转化率。
- 个人博客:博客作者可以使用视频画廊来展示视频内容或图片故事。
5. 使用方法
使用RoyalSlider插件通常需要进行以下步骤:
- 引入jQuery和RoyalSlider的JavaScript和CSS文件到项目中。
- 准备HTML结构,定义画廊的容器以及图片和视频等内容的标记。
- 编写JavaScript代码初始化RoyalSlider实例,并配置相应的选项参数。
- 根据需求进行样式自定义,确保与网站主题风格一致。
6. 代码示例
以下是一个简单的RoyalSlider初始化代码示例:
```javascript
<script src="jquery.min.js"></script>
<script src="royalslider.js"></script>
<link rel="stylesheet" href="royalslider.css" type="text/css" media="screen" />
<div class="royalSlider">
<div><img src="image1.jpg" /></div>
<div><img src="image2.jpg" /></div>
<div><iframe src="video1.html"></iframe></div>
</div>
<script type="text/javascript">
$(function(){
$('.royalSlider').royalSlider({
arrowsNav: true,
controlNavigation: 'bullets',
autoPlay: true,
autoPlayDelay: 4000,
keyboardNavEnabled: true,
});
});
</script>
```
上述代码展示了如何通过RoyalSlider插件创建一个具有箭头导航、自动播放、分页点和键盘导航功能的画廊。
7. 插件扩展与维护
RoyalSlider插件的源代码通常是开源的,允许开发者对其进行修改和扩展。同时,开发者社区也会提供各种插件或脚本,以增强该插件的功能。由于其维护良好,新版本会不断修复已知的问题并添加新功能,确保插件在前端技术发展的过程中保持兼容性和功能性。
总结而言,视频画廊RoyalSlider插件是一款功能强大的前端展示工具,它结合了jQuery、HTML5和CSS3等技术,为创建交互式内容画廊提供了丰富而灵活的解决方案。通过它的应用,开发者可以大大提升网页的视觉效果和用户体验。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2021-03-20 上传
2021-11-17 上传
2019-07-11 上传
2019-07-11 上传
2019-07-14 上传
2022-11-24 上传
芝麻粒儿
- 粉丝: 6w+
- 资源: 2万+